    Ok, let me see if I understand the logic here.

    A directory owner allows free submissions, just long enough that it boosts the PR of the directory and SERP standings to the point that the directory owner no longer has a use for the free listings. He then deletes the listings and tries to use the PR (That we helped him gain) to make people pay to keep the free listing they got in the first place. :eek::eek:

    IMO...This has nothing to do with getting better position for paid listings, and it has a whole lot to do with the owner wishing he had gotten paid for all those free links he gave away.

    Why not just mod your dir so that paid listings are always listed BEFORE free listings? It would be a very easy mod, and would be a lot easier to understand the logic.
